Comprehending Emergency Property Protection
Emergency property protection describes the set of measures enacted to secure properties from prospective damage or theft during crises such as typhoons, floods, fires, or civil discontent. Effective property protection can involve both physical barriers and tactical preparation, thus decreasing vulnerability throughout emergencies.

An effective emergency strategy consists of evacuation paths, communication plans for relative, and a list of essential contacts and resources.
How typically should I evaluate my emergency plan?
It is a good idea to review and update your emergency strategy at least once a year, or after any significant modifications to your property or household situation.
What kinds of insurance coverage should I consider?
You need to think about property owners insurance, flood insurance coverage (if at risk), and additional coverage for high-value products like art work or jewelry.
Are wise home security devices worth the financial investment?
Yes, smart home security gadgets not just improve property protection however can also supply peace of mind by permitting real-time monitoring from anywhere.
How can I secure my property throughout a natural catastrophe?
Throughout natural catastrophe warnings, reinforce doors and windows, secure outside products, produce a sandbag dam if flooding is prepared for, and communicate your strategies with household and next-door neighbors.
